Python like r-studio download

Rstudio is an open source integrated development environment ide for creating and running r code. I am planning on learning how to code in python, primarily just for fun and to learn how to code up bots like the ones we see in reddit comments. This was by design although perhaps we can still reconsider. The licenses page details gplcompatibility and terms and conditions. Check that rstudio is working appropriately by opening it from your start menu. If would you like continue configuring rstudio connect using the trial evaluation license. Why doesnt python have a decent ide like r does with.

Note also how this interface is quite similar to rstudio. Mar 11, 2020 python can pretty much do the same tasks as r. However, there are python libraries such as 2to3 that automate translation between the two versions. Publishing a python api to rstudio connect requires the rsconnectpython package. Installing and configuring python with rstudio rstudio. Miniconda is an open source environment management system for python. Publishing a python api to rstudio connect requires the rsconnect python package. Dec 17, 2015 so have you been looking for something like rstudio, but for python. In wing you can either select and execute code in the integrated python shell or if youre debugging something you can interact with the paused debug program in a shell called the debug probe. Oct 12, 2019 would you like to download and install miniconda. Download rstudio rstudio is a set of integrated tools designed to help you be more productive with r. Python works well for webscrapping, text processing, file manipulations, and simple or complex visualizations. Python is a tool to deploy and implement machine learning at a largescale. Spyder is an acronym for scientific python development environment and it offers a lot.

Theres a few things to note here were going to install everything through anaconda instead of using the rpython package managers. Recently i have been writing some python code and i was wondering if anyone know what the equivalent to an r package in python is. Examples for each of these extensions can be found in the user guide. Initially used in research and academics, r has become more than just a statistical language. So have you been looking for something like rstudio, but for python. I was, a while ago, looking for something like rstudio but for python. Historically, most, but not all, python releases have also been gplcompatible. Many r users enjoy working in rstudio, but its not your only option for reproducible research in r. A cross platform ide for python, includs code edit, auto complete, debuger etc. Visual studio python ide python development tools for.

When the download is complete, click on the downloaded file and it will begin to install. Controlling rstudio python child processes rbloggers. Download you can download the lightweight pycharm ide for python and. The data that well be using to test out the python functionality comes from wes mckinneys creator of pandas python for data analysis book. Visual studio python ide python development tools for windows.

Sas or r or python or sql which one is best for you. Thats fine if the process is going to exit, but tasks like a flask app will just. Cran is also used as a package manager with more than 10,000 packages available for download. Visit our github page to see or participate in ptvs development. You can configure python on the system path so that users can use pip within a terminal to install packages to their home directory, similar to how r works with. Question about ides similar to rstudio to use with python. I think there is some kind of misunderstanding going on here, you cant import pandas without installing it first, regardless of the ide you are using.

The best python ides for data science that make data analysis and machine. Oct 08, 2018 python objects all exist in a single persistent session so are usable across chunks just like r objects. Any chance there will be expanded python support in a future version of rstudio. Apr 30, 2020 learn the fundamentals of coding and how to import, analyze, and visualize data in five minutes per day. I asked some software engineers at my office but they didnt really get the question, since they dont know that much about r. Step 3 configure authentication rstudio documentation. Jupyter notebook previously known as ipython notebook is a really cool project for interactive data manipulation in python and other languages, including r. I know that the editor has support awesome and python scripts run in the r console with systemafter clicking on run script also awesome, but it would be amazing to have all the tools we have for r in rstudio available for python too. We believe free and open source data analysis software is a foundation for innovative and important work in science, education, and industry. The reticulate package provides a comprehensive set of tools for interoperability between python and r. Is there a similar interface to rstudio for python. Sas remains the leading language for corporate analytics on the desktop but it remains expensive for small enterprises and has a significant disadvantage in capital expenditure commitment because of annual license. A more nuanced answer is that there is a variety of other setups which dont duplicate but. Information on contributors to the r project can be obtained by entering contributors at the prompt.

With the latest integration of python into the rstudio ide, rstudio is making. Heres the github repo where you can download the pydatabook materials. The history tab shows a list of commands used so far. Some other systems are better than r at this, and part of the thrust of this manual is to suggest that rather than duplicating functionality in r we can make another system do the work. The same source code archive can also be used to build. The perfect solution for professionals who need to balance work, family, and career building.

It basically allows you to interactively code and document what youre doing in one interface and later on save it as a. How to install rstudio for free on windows 1087 youtube. Creating a list with just five development environments for data science with python is a hard task. Features just like other ides, pycharm has interesting features such as a code editor, errors highlighting, a powerful debugger with a graphical interface, besides of git integration, svn. Using python in the rstudio ide machine learning tutorials. If would you like continue configuring rstudio connect using the trial evaluation license, then skip to step 1d. For example, if you define a python object and want to use it later, you need to save it to disk. Python objects all exist in a single persistent session so are usable across chunks just like r objects. Nov 04, 2017 wing ide, and probably also other python ides like pycharm and pydev have features like this. Advantages of using r for cloud and iaas, paas, saas are explained. If you are working on your local machine, you can install python from python.

I dont have much experience aside from work ive done with r, and i got really accustomed to the interface with r, like having your main coding window, along with a windows that showed when you created. The files tab shows all the files and folders in your default workspace as if you were on. Programming languages like python and r have become the main choice for researchers and practitioners in the field of data science to process and analyze data both for research and business purposes. Specific help information can be found by entering the specific topic you are looking for information about, e. Calling python from r in a variety of ways including r markdown, sourcing python scripts, importing python modules, and using python interactively within an r session. It also has useful links for documentation, forums, books, blogs, packages, and more for r and rstudio. The many customers who value our professional software capabilities help us contribute to this community. Another free languagesoftware, python has great capabilities overall for general purpose functional programming. Finally, an ide that does both python and r well atom. In addition to python, pycharm provides support for javascript, htmlcss, angular js, node. Any python package you install from pypi or conda can be used from r with. Introduction to use cloud computing in r programming and r studio is defined. We offer courses in python, r, and sql that are 100% optimized for mobile and taught by expert instructors. Installing and configuring python with rstudio rstudio support.

Rstudiolike python ides rodeo and spyder pybloggers. Paid for pycharm has best remote debugging but i dont think you want to go there. Sometimes, id like to use some python bash for the parts that r isnt super good at. How to install r studio for free on windows 1087 find more python tutorials at my blog links download rstudio. But when i run import pandas as pd getting the below error. May 22, 2019 when i write r functions i have the habit to put them in packages, which is supersmooth with help packages such as devtools and usethis. Running a long python job from rstudio, or running something like a flask app from within rstudio means a having blocked rsession until the child process exits. Im fairly confident in my ability to learn python once im up and running but i am intimidated by the number of ides. Wing ide, and probably also other python ides like pycharm and pydev have features like this. For example, if you have a competition that uses 30 gb of data, it is. Python didnt have many data analysis and machine learning libraries.

The editor is a multilanguage editor with a functionclass browser. You want to make it easier to use them in different projects and also to share with collaborators. Then rstudio would be a real data science ide python ones. Rstudiolike python ides rodeo and spyder erik marsja. Rstudio connect automatically integrates with several flask extension packages like flaskrestx, flaskapi, and flasgger to provide webaccessible documentation or an api console interface. I want to learn python because it seems to be more popular in industry i do academic work. Rstudio connect offers a variety of user authentication methods. In general, statistical systems like r are not particularly well suited to manipulations of largescale data. R expert hopes to settle the debate with an analysis of. How to use python in rstudio rstudio ide rstudio community.

Many popular opensource ides such as the r studio can be used to run r. Therefore, for a beginner in the field of data science, r is a highly recommended programming language to master. If you havent already, youll want to get r and python setup and configured for use with atom. Only printed outputs or errors are captured and placed into the notebook. Users users appdata roaming microsoft windowsstartmenuprogramspython3. Designed for beginners and advanced users, datacamps mobile coding courses offer the most indepth content available in the app store today.

Jul 22, 2016 many r users enjoy working in rstudio, but its not your only option for reproducible research in r. Jun 21, 2015 python is free just like r, but the main reason r scores is that the statistical library of r packages is far more extensive. The console is where you can type commands and see output the workspace tab shows all the active objects see next slide. Python equivalent to r package package development. I want to ask for your experiance with python editors. Python codes are easier to maintain and more robust than r. Learn the fundamentals of coding and how to import, analyze, and visualize data in five minutes per day. Rstudio connect helps you share intearctive python content such as flask or. For most unix systems, you must download and compile the source code. The layout resembles the rstudio layout file editor top left, interactive console bottom left, variable inspector and history top right.

R script 1 the usual rstudio screen has four windows. Help can easily be found by entering help at the r prompt. Its available in versions for windows, mac, and linux. The following steps represent a minimal workflow for using python with rstudio connect via the reticulate package, whether you are using the rstudio ide on your local machine or rstudio server pro step 1 install a base version of python. Curiously enough ive noticed if i start an new rmarkdown document, that the following code works. R and python objects are also shared across languages with conversions done automatically when required e. Python libraries import pandas as pd import numpy as np import. Ideas even without the r plugin has superior editor, database support, vcs integration, markdown authoring, and excellent support for other datasiencerelated languages like bash, python or scala, if youre focus is more ronly workflows, rnotebooks, the embedded table viewer, and r plugindevelopment, rstudio excels. R can be easily downloaded from cran the comprehensive r archive network.

It includes a console, syntaxhighlighting editor that supports direct code execution, and a variety of robust tools for plotting, viewing history, debugging and managing your workspace. I think the specific answer to your question is that rstudio has only been set up for r, and for those folks, they specific engineered rstudio for r only. Sep 16, 2017 how to install r studio for free on windows 1087 find more python tutorials at my blog links download rstudio. Python tools for visual studio is a completely free extension, developed and supported by microsoft with contributions from the community.

You can install python packages such as numpy, pandas, matplotlib, and other packages in your python virtualenv by using pip install using. Stephen wahlbrink has written a plugin for eclipse, statet, that offers similar functionality to rstudio within the popular eclipse framework. However, in r studio i really appreciate that it holds data frames in the memory and makes it easy to viewinspect dataframes and other items. Its been out for some time, but a recently updated release of rodeo gives an increasingly workable rstudiolike environment for python users. Jun 28, 2019 after installing python i am not able to install pandas using python due to network issue network restriction. Rstudio tutorial the basics you need to master techvidvan. It is important that you configure the desired method before logging into rstudio connect for the first time. Python resource managers resource managers kubernetes slurm.

With the help tab, you can search for commands you need help with. Its a tool for doing the computation and numbercrunching that set the stage for statistical analysis and decisionmaking. You can install python packages from r console this way. Free, fullyfeatured ide for students, opensource and individual.

R expert hopes to settle the debate with an analysis of the programming languages thats fair and helpful. Python scientific stack includes numpy, scipy, matplotlib, ipython, pandas, statsmodels, scikitlearn, and pymc. Press question mark to learn the rest of the keyboard shortcuts. My impression is that it seems to better support an rstudiolike workflow. There are other ways to do this, but i prefer this method.